face lift s65 question...issue with drl's

So I got the 65 front fitted and installed. The drl's and kit were supplied via suvneer. We hooked them up directly to the side marker lights that no longer exist in the new bumper.

The problem is that when the car comes on, the drl's flash 4 or 5 times at about the speed of the hazard lights would normally go and then go off and stay off.

I have been recommended by Gary to install some load resistors to rectify the voltage issues. I picked up a set and plan on installing tomorrow.

My question is has anyone had to do this before? While I'm optimistic about the fix, I do pick up the car tomorrow and want to make sure I get this fixed as I paid good money for the paint and install. If this doesnt work i dont know what else to do other than tie into the fogs. The car is an 07 600...thanks

I believe Gary sells the S63 facelift kit, not the S65. When I spoke with him several months ago about his kit, he said that the DRL bar plugs directly into the side marker lights and that no resistors are needed. He said that the only time you might need resistors is if you were trying to run them to your stock fog light harness, which could also entail some wire splicing.


I'm interested in finding out what works for you, and what you decide to do with your stock fog lights. Gary mentioned leaving the bulbs in so that no warning lights are triggered....and tucking them behind the bumper, but I find this to be less than ideal.


To me, the ideal situation would be to somehow run the DRL bar to the same circuit that allows the DRL's on our cars in the headlights. Then he could add the side markers in his bumper without any modification. Then we'd need some low heat resistors to plug into the fog light socket.

S63 and S65 have the same body kit.

I didn't use the foglights, because I don't want to manually switch them on. Outside of the US there isn't side-markers. I got them wired to ignition live.

I didn't even bother putting bulbs into the foglight bulb holders. The warning doesn't come on unless you manually try to switch on foglights.

Engine on, DRL on.
